REMOVAL AND INSTALLATION
CAN GATEWAY
Removal and Installation
INFOID:0000000009175003
CAUTION:
Before replacing CAN gateway, perform “Before Replace ECU” of “Read / Write Configuration” to save
or print current vehicle specification. Refer to
REMOVAL
1. Remove the AV control unit. Refer to
AV-611, "Removal and Installation"
2. Remove the screw from the bracket of the automatic drive
positioner control unit .
3. Position the automatic drive positioner control unit aside and
remove the CAN gateway from the bracket by sliding it as
shown.
4. Disconnect the harness connector from the CAN gateway and remove the CAN gateway.
INSTALLATION
Installation is in the reverse order of removal.
CAUTION:
To prevent malfunction, be sure to perform “After Replace ECU” of “Read / Write Configuration” or
“Manual Configuration” when replacing CAN gateway. Refer to

ECM BRANCH LINE CIRCUIT
ECM BRANCH LINE CIRCUIT
Diagnosis Procedure
INFOID:0000000009175006
1.
CHECK CONNECTOR
1. Turn the ignition switch OFF.
2. Disconnect the battery cable from the negative terminal.
3. Check the terminals and connectors of the ECM for damage, bend and loose connection (unit side and
connector side).
Is the inspection result normal?
YES
>> GO TO 2.
NO
>> Repair the terminal and connector.
2.
CHECK HARNESS FOR OPEN CIRCUIT
1. Disconnect the connector of ECM.
2. Check the resistance between the ECM harness connector terminals.
Is the measurement value within the specification?
YES
>> GO TO 3.
NO
>> Repair the ECM branch line.
3.
CHECK POWER SUPPLY AND GROUND CIRCUIT
Check the power supply and the ground circuit of the ECM. Refer to
Is the inspection result normal?
YES (Present error)>>Replace the ECM. Refer to
EC-466, "Removal and Installation"
YES (Past error)>>Error was detected in the ECM branch line.
NO
>> Repair the power supply and the ground circuit.
